- [ ] **Step 7: Breaker override escrow.** After sealing the signing keys for the Tallgrove upstream API circuit breaker, confirm the support team can force the breaker open during a full outage. The override bundle lives in the sealed escrow drawer and is useless without its unlock phrase. Two ceremony witnesses must initial this step before proceeding. The escrow bundle is decrypted with the recovery passphrase that follows.

vault phrase of kahip-kahop = holath-quenmir

## Deployment

PickPath (our warehouse pick-list optimizer) ships as a single container. Nothing exotic, reviewer friend — build it, push it to the Halver registry, and the scheduler picks it up. The only gotcha is that the route solver needs its tuning knobs set before first boot, or it falls back to naive aisle ordering, which is embarrassing. All the knobs live in one config block. The values we currently deploy with are listed below.

deployment values, yadup-kadug:
[sorys]
port = 5672
team = noveth
host = sorys.orvexcorp.example
region = south-4
access_code = ac_deddc1
timeout_ms = 1500

### Account Recovery — Catalogue Import (Lintwood)

Quick one for review: when the Lintwood catalogue import wipes a patron's session table, the recovery flow re-seeds accounts from the nightly snapshot. Check that the importer skips locked accounts — last time it didn't. To rerun recovery against staging you'll need the vault passphrase, which is appended just below.

recovery phrase for yafof-tajof: julmir-kelax-julvan-holath-belvan-holir-ralael-ralvan-ralath-julvan-silmir-istmir-kaswyn-ulamir